Pool prep yard leveling services involve adjusting the ground surface around a swimming pool to ensure it is even and properly supported. This process typically includes removing any uneven patches of soil, filling in low spots, and grading the yard to create a smooth, stable base for the pool. Proper yard leveling is essential before installing a new pool or performing repairs on an existing one, as it helps prevent future issues related to shifting or settling. Skilled service providers use specialized equipment and techniques to achieve a level yard that provides a secure foundation for the pool structure.

One of the primary problems yard leveling helps solve is uneven ground that can cause the pool to become unstable or develop cracks over time. When the yard is not properly prepared, the weight of the pool can lead to shifting or settling, which may result in water loss, damage to the pool shell, or safety hazards for swimmers. Additionally, an uneven yard can make maintenance more difficult and impact the overall appearance of the pool area. By ensuring the ground is level, homeowners can enjoy a safer, more durable pool setup that minimizes the risk of costly repairs later on.

The overview below groups typical Pool Prep Yard Leveling proj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Reno, NV.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typically, local contractors charge between $250 and $600 for routine yard leveling work around a pool area. Many projects fall within this range, especially for minor adjustments and surface smoothing. Larger or more complex repairs can exceed this range, but they are less common.

Moderate Yard Leveling - For more extensive leveling involving significant adjustments, costs often range from $600 to $1,500. These projects usually involve larger areas or moderate soil movement and are a common choice for many homeowners. Higher-end projects may reach up to $2,500 for more detailed work.

Full Yard Preparation - Complete yard leveling or preparation for pool installation can cost between $1,500 and $3,500. Many local service providers handle projects within this band, which covers larger surface areas and more complex soil work. Projects exceeding this range are less frequent but may involve additional grading or landscaping.

Complete Replacement or Major Regrading - Larger, more complex projects such as full yard regrading or extensive soil replacement can reach $3,500 and above, with some jobs exceeding $5,000. These are typically less common and involve significant excavation, soil stabilization, and landscape redesign efforts.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is yard leveling for pool prep? Yard leveling for pool prep involves adjusting the terrain to create a flat, stable surface suitable for installing a pool, helping prevent settling and shifting over time.

Why is yard leveling important before pool installation? Proper yard leveling ensures the pool sits on a stable foundation, reducing the risk of uneven surfaces, cracking, or damage once the pool is filled and in use.

How do local contractors typically level a yard for a pool? Contractors may use grading techniques, soil adjustments, and compacting methods to achieve a level surface tailored to the pool's specifications.

What types of soil or ground conditions can affect yard leveling? Loose, uneven, or clay-heavy soils can complicate leveling efforts, requiring specific preparation or soil amendments to ensure stability.

Can yard leveling also improve drainage around a pool area? Yes, proper leveling can help direct water away from the pool area, reducing potential flooding or erosion issues over time.
